The Colt Combat Officer’s Model (Model No. 09846CO) is a Custom Shop 1911 variant produced in 1987, representing one of Colt’s most distinctive compact designs of the era. It showcases a striking two-tone finish, pairing a stainless steel slide with a deeply blue steel frame, and comes equipped with three-white-dot combat sights for quick target acquisition. The genuine stag grips add both elegance and individuality, setting this model apart from standard production pistols. Built around a 3 1/2-inch barrel, the Combat Officer’s combines the shorter Officer’s ACP frame with the proven reliability and handling of the classic 1911 platform, delivering a compact yet accurate and well-balanced sidearm. Although it is often regarded as a limited-production Custom Shop model, Colt never released official production numbers, enhancing its air of exclusivity. Today, it stands as a sought-after collectible, prized for its craftsmanship, uncommon configuration, and its place in Colt’s lineage of 1911 pistols.
